The rehab rumour sprang into action at the beginning of this year, when Ms Winehouse checked herself into a clinic for treatment over apparent drug addiction, before leaving again two weeks later.

More recently, Amy’s been snapped out and about with painful-looking sores on her face, reigniting fears over her health.

The Sun newspaper reported that she was coming to terms with the idea of rehab once more, with a source saying:

"Amy has admitted she needs to check into rehab again.

"There are too many temptations for her in the UK - people around her in London are making it impossible for her to stay clean for any length of time.

"Her management considered sending her to a clinic in Israel but are now looking further afield. They are assessing a clinic in Cape Town in South Africa."

However, Amy’s peeps have dismissed the claims, telling Us magazine:

"Amy’s doing well. She is not going back to rehab at this time.

They added: "The problem is that her face looks bad because of impetigo — it’s not a nice thing, but it’s not related to drugs. It’s a bacterial infection."

They said that Amy was now "having time off, recording a bit at her home studios, about to go back into the studio properly and working towards her husband’s freedom".
